Common signs of raccoons in East Lyme homes:

* Thumping, rustling, or heavy footsteps in attics or chimneys at night

* Chewed vents, soffits, or roof edges (entry holes often baseball-sized)

* Scattered trash, tipped cans, or raided bird feeders near marinas or yards

* Grease marks or dark stains on walls/siding from raccoon oils

* Droppings (tubular, dark, often with berries/seed bits) in attic corners or near entry points

* Young raccoons chirping/whining in spring (March–April)


Our process is simple and effective:

1. Free on-site inspection to locate dens, entry points, and damage.

2. Secure live trapping with heavy-duty traps and remote camera monitoring for real-time alerts.

3. Eviction and exclusion (one-way doors where possible, permanent sealing with hardware cloth and metal).

4. Repairs and cleanup (droppings removal, sanitization, restoration).

5. Prevention (secure trash, trim branches, block entry points).

  Relocating Raccoons Is Illegal in Connecticut


When it comes to raccoon trapping and removal in East Lyme, CT, it's important to know the laws upfront. In Connecticut, **it is illegal to relocate raccoons** and other rabies vector species (like skunks and foxes) according to state statutes and the Department of Energy and Environmental Protection (DEEP).


Relocation can spread rabies to new areas, stress or harm the animal, and often doesn't solve the problem long-term (they can return or cause issues elsewhere). DEEP requires licensed wildlife control operators to handle them humanely and legally — usually live trapping followed by euthanasia if needed, or exclusion when possible.
